
Excel卡了文件打不开的原因可能有多种,包括文件过大、内存不足、Excel版本不兼容、文件损坏、插件冲突、病毒感染。下面将详细展开其中一个原因,并进一步探讨其他常见原因及其解决方案。
文件过大是Excel卡顿或无法打开的常见原因之一。当Excel文件包含大量数据、复杂的公式、或多个图表和图片时,文件大小可能会显著增加,这导致Excel在打开文件时需要消耗大量的内存和计算资源。如果电脑的硬件配置较低,尤其是内存不足,Excel在处理这些大文件时可能会变得非常缓慢,甚至卡死。
为了避免文件过大导致的问题,可以采取以下措施:
- 优化文件内容:删除不必要的数据、简化公式、减少图表和图片的数量。
- 分割文件:将一个大的Excel文件分割成多个较小的文件,以减轻单个文件的负担。
- 使用外部数据源:如果数据量非常大,可以考虑将数据存储在数据库中,通过Excel的外部数据源功能进行读取。
一、文件过大
Excel文件过大不仅会导致卡顿,还会影响打开和保存文件的速度。大文件通常包含大量的行和列、复杂的公式、大量的图表和图片。
1. 优化数据和公式
对于包含大量数据的Excel文件,可以通过以下几种方法进行优化:
- 删除不必要的数据:定期清理无用的数据和空白行列,以减少文件的大小。
- 简化公式:复杂的公式会占用大量的计算资源,尝试将复杂的公式拆分成多个简单的公式,或使用Excel的内置函数进行替换。
- 减少图表和图片:图表和图片会显著增加文件的大小,删除不必要的图表和图片,或将其转换为更小的格式。
2. 分割文件
如果文件过大,考虑将其分割成多个较小的文件。例如,将一个包含多个工作表的大文件分割成多个独立的文件,每个文件只包含一个工作表。这不仅能减轻单个文件的负担,还能提高文件的读取和保存速度。
二、内存不足
内存不足是导致Excel卡顿和无法打开文件的另一个常见原因。Excel需要足够的内存来加载和处理文件,如果电脑的内存不足,Excel可能会变得非常缓慢,甚至无法打开文件。
1. 增加电脑内存
增加电脑的内存是解决内存不足问题的最直接方法。现代的操作系统和软件对内存的需求越来越高,建议将电脑的内存升级到至少8GB,如果可能,升级到16GB或更高。
2. 关闭不必要的程序
在使用Excel时,尽量关闭其他不必要的程序,以释放更多的内存和计算资源给Excel使用。这包括浏览器、邮件客户端和其他后台运行的程序。
三、Excel版本不兼容
不同版本的Excel之间可能存在不兼容的问题,尤其是在使用最新功能和格式时。如果使用的Excel版本较旧,可能会无法打开使用新版本创建的文件。
1. 升级Excel版本
使用最新版本的Excel可以最大程度地避免版本不兼容的问题。最新版本的Excel通常包含最新的功能和性能优化,能够更好地处理大型文件和复杂的公式。
2. 保存为兼容格式
如果需要与使用旧版本Excel的用户共享文件,可以将文件保存为兼容格式。例如,将Excel文件保存为“.xls”格式,而不是“.xlsx”格式,这样可以确保旧版本的Excel也能打开文件。
四、文件损坏
文件损坏是导致Excel文件无法打开的常见原因之一。文件损坏可能是由于硬盘故障、病毒感染、不正确的保存操作等原因导致的。
1. 使用Excel内置修复工具
Excel提供了内置的修复工具,可以尝试修复损坏的文件。在打开文件时,如果Excel检测到文件损坏,会自动提示进行修复。
2. 使用第三方修复工具
如果Excel内置的修复工具无法修复文件,可以尝试使用第三方修复工具。这些工具通常具有更强的修复能力,能够修复更多类型的文件损坏。
五、插件冲突
Excel插件可以扩展Excel的功能,但同时也可能导致冲突和性能问题。如果安装了大量的插件,某些插件之间可能会发生冲突,导致Excel卡顿或无法打开文件。
1. 禁用不必要的插件
在Excel中禁用不必要的插件,可以减少插件之间的冲突,提高Excel的性能。可以在Excel的“选项”菜单中管理插件,禁用不常用的插件。
2. 使用兼容的插件
确保安装的插件与当前使用的Excel版本兼容。不兼容的插件可能会导致Excel出现各种问题,包括卡顿和无法打开文件。
六、病毒感染
病毒感染可能会导致Excel文件损坏或无法打开,甚至导致整个系统的性能下降。为了防止病毒感染,需要采取适当的防护措施。
1. 安装杀毒软件
安装并定期更新杀毒软件,可以有效防止病毒感染。杀毒软件可以实时监控系统,检测并清除病毒,保护Excel文件的安全。
2. 定期备份文件
定期备份Excel文件,可以在文件损坏或丢失时进行恢复。可以将文件备份到外部硬盘、云存储或其他安全的存储介质。
七、系统问题
系统问题如操作系统故障、硬盘故障、内存故障等也可能导致Excel文件无法打开。对于这种情况,需要进行系统层面的检查和维护。
1. 检查硬盘健康状况
使用系统自带的磁盘检查工具或第三方硬盘检测软件,定期检查硬盘的健康状况,修复可能存在的错误,以确保硬盘的正常运行。
2. 更新操作系统
保持操作系统和Excel的更新,可以修复已知的漏洞和错误,提升系统的稳定性和性能。定期检查并安装系统更新和补丁,是确保系统正常运行的重要措施。
八、网络问题
如果Excel文件存储在网络驱动器或云存储中,网络问题也可能导致文件无法打开。例如,网络连接不稳定、带宽不足等。
1. 检查网络连接
确保网络连接稳定,避免在网络不稳定时访问网络驱动器或云存储中的文件。可以通过更换网络环境、重启路由器等方法,提高网络连接的稳定性。
2. 本地备份文件
将重要的Excel文件备份到本地硬盘,即使网络出现问题,也可以通过本地备份文件进行访问和编辑。
九、文件权限问题
文件权限设置不正确,可能导致Excel文件无法打开。例如,文件被设置为只读或没有足够的访问权限。
1. 检查文件权限
检查文件的权限设置,确保当前用户具有足够的访问权限。可以通过文件属性菜单或系统设置,修改文件的权限。
2. 获取管理员权限
如果当前用户没有足够的权限,可以尝试获取管理员权限,或联系系统管理员进行权限设置。
十、Excel配置问题
Excel的配置文件可能会损坏或设置不当,导致Excel无法正常工作。这种情况可以通过重置Excel配置或重新安装Excel来解决。
1. 重置Excel配置
在Excel的“选项”菜单中,可以找到重置配置的选项,通过重置配置,可以恢复Excel的默认设置,解决由于配置问题导致的故障。
2. 重新安装Excel
如果重置配置无法解决问题,可以尝试重新安装Excel。通过卸载并重新安装Excel,可以修复可能存在的安装问题和配置错误。
结论
Excel卡顿或无法打开文件的问题,可能由多种原因导致。通过逐一排查文件过大、内存不足、Excel版本不兼容、文件损坏、插件冲突、病毒感染、系统问题、网络问题、文件权限问题、Excel配置问题等因素,可以找到问题的根源,并采取相应的解决措施。上述方法不仅能解决Excel卡顿和无法打开文件的问题,还能提高Excel的整体性能和稳定性。
相关问答FAQs:
1. 我的Excel文件打不开,该怎么办?
- 问题描述: 我尝试打开一个Excel文件,但是它卡在打开的过程中,无法正常加载。我该如何解决这个问题?
- 回答: 首先,你可以尝试重新启动你的电脑,有时候这样可以解决一些临时的问题。如果仍然无法打开,可以尝试以下方法:
- 检查文件路径是否正确,确保你正在尝试打开正确的文件。
- 检查文件是否受到保护或加密,如果是,请提供正确的密码进行解锁。
- 尝试打开其他Excel文件,如果其他文件可以正常打开,那么可能是该文件本身出现了问题。
- 尝试使用其他版本的Excel打开该文件,有时候不同版本之间的兼容性会导致文件无法打开。
- 如果你有备份文件,可以尝试打开备份文件,以确定是否是文件本身出现了问题。
- 如果以上方法都无效,你可以尝试使用Excel的修复工具进行修复,或者尝试使用其他的文件修复软件进行修复。
2. 我的Excel文件卡在打开的过程中,是什么原因导致的?
- 问题描述: 当我尝试打开一个Excel文件时,它卡在打开的过程中,无法继续加载。我想知道是什么原因导致的这个问题?
- 回答: Excel文件打不开的原因可能有很多,以下是一些可能导致文件卡住的原因:
- 文件过大:如果你的Excel文件非常大,可能会导致加载时间过长,甚至无法完全加载。
- 文件损坏:如果文件在传输或保存过程中出现了错误,可能会导致文件损坏,进而无法正常打开。
- 兼容性问题:如果你正在尝试打开一个较新版本的Excel文件,而你的Excel版本较旧,可能会导致兼容性问题,无法正常打开。
- 病毒感染:如果你的电脑受到了病毒感染,可能会导致Excel文件无法正常打开。
- 资源占用:如果你的电脑资源占用过高,可能会导致Excel文件卡住,无法继续加载。
3. 我的Excel文件无法打开,是否有办法恢复数据?
- 问题描述: 我有一个非常重要的Excel文件,但是突然无法打开了,里面有我所有的数据。请问是否有办法恢复这些数据?
- 回答: 是的,有一些方法可以尝试恢复无法打开的Excel文件中的数据:
- 使用Excel自带的修复工具:Excel有一些内置的修复工具,可以尝试使用这些工具来修复损坏的文件并恢复数据。
- 使用第三方文件修复软件:有一些专门用于修复损坏的Excel文件的第三方软件,可以尝试使用这些软件来恢复数据。
- 找回备份文件:如果你有备份文件,可以尝试打开备份文件来恢复数据。
- 请教专业人士:如果以上方法都无法解决问题,建议咨询专业的数据恢复人员,他们可能有更高级的方法来恢复你的数据。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4687045